Use of Spare Time
NOTHING is more tiring than sitting
about without a definite thing to occupy
one's mind. Idle time is deadening.
It is demoralizing. It is wasteful.
Reading is interesting to most persons.
Many crave the opportunity and time for
it. Study is attractive to a certain type of
mind. But reading becomes tiresome after
a certain length of time. Study brings
drowsiness if the day happens to be warm.
With a view to utilizing the time of the
men between engagements, while holding
the staff together during the least busy
season of the year, the firm, through the
Department for Professional Training,
has instituted a series of staff conferences.
These are being held at the Executive Offices,
469 Fifth Avenue.
The work is built around a graded and
logical collection of material dealing with
the theory and practice of accounting, together
with such subjects as law, finance,
economics, organization and management
in their relation to accounting, and the
theory, practice, and technique of accountancy,
with special reference to the technique
of the firm.
Lectures by Mr. Wildman and Mr. C.
M. Clark are followed by the work of
solving and discussing problems correlated
with the theory.
It is hoped that these conferences will
serve not only to occupy to advantage
what would otherwise be spare time, but be
instrumental in producing a better trained
and more effective staff for service during
the busy season.
